Job Summary
Reviewing medical records and validating diagnosis information, the full-time Risk Adjustment Coding Specialist will work remotely to ensure accurate risk adjustment coding while adhering to established guidelines and departmental procedures.
Key Responsibilities
- Review medical records to identify clinical documentation supporting diagnosis reporting and risk adjustment activities
- Validate diagnosis codes selected by providers to ensure documentation supports accurate and compliant coding
- Collaborate with providers and internal stakeholders to obtain clarification regarding documentation requirements
Required Qualifications
- High school diploma or GED required
- Active coding credential through AAPC or AHIMA required; CRC preferred
- Minimum one year of healthcare, outpatient, coding, or related medical experience preferred
- Working knowledge of ICD-10-CM coding conventions and medical terminology
- Foundational understanding of anatomy, physiology, disease processes, and pharmacology
